Navicat连接Oracle数据库:Oracle library is not loaded 解决方案
报错解释:
Navicat 是一款数据库管理工具,当尝试使用它连接 Oracle 数据库时,如果遇到 "Oracle library is not loaded" 错误,通常意味着 Navicat 无法加载 Oracle 客户端库(如 oci.dll),这可能是因为 Oracle 客户端未正确安装或配置。
解决方法:
- 确认 Oracle 客户端已安装在计算机上。
- 如果已安装,确保环境变量正确设置。需要设置的环境变量通常包括
PATH
和ORACLE_HOME
。PATH
应包括 Oracle 客户端库路径(例如,%ORACLE_HOME%\bin
)。 - 确认 Navicat 使用的 Oracle 客户端版本与数据库服务器版本兼容。
- 如果问题依旧,尝试重新安装 Oracle 客户端或更新到与数据库兼容的版本。
- 重新启动计算机以确保所有环境变量更改生效。
- 如果你使用的是 64 位版本的 Navicat 和 Oracle 客户端,请确保它们是匹配的(都是 32 位或 64 位)。
如果以上步骤无法解决问题,可以查看 Oracle 官方文档或者联系技术支持获取更具体的帮助。
评论已关闭